Pork potstickers step by step

  1. Take 1 cup of flour, salt and water; mix together until it makes a dough (add more flour if needed).
  2. The 1/2 cup of flour spread that on a clean level base and knead dough until it no longer is sticking on hands.
  3. Roll dough into a snake form and cut 1 inch pieces and put aside.
  4. Take all ingredients for the filling and mix together.
  5. Get one of the dough pieces and roll it out to make a circle, place a spoon full of the filling mixture in the middle of dough.
  6. Fold dough over and either you can close with a fork or you can pinch the dough together to close; repeat this until all potstickers are made.
  7. Take a skillet and grease it with a little butter; place a couple potstickers in pan and brown on each side...then turn on low heat and add 1/3 cup of water and cover to let potstickers steam until cooked all the way bout 15mins.
  8. Done and serve with soy sauce or your choice of sauce.
